  • Hi there, 

     

    So after a month or two of waiting on the NHS, I decided to go private as I kept being pushed down the waiting list due to my age. It turned out to be Fibroadenoma (Thank God)! However, the lump is still there, but I was told it probably wouldn't go away, which is slightly more reassuring. I still have slight pain sometimes, but from reading various forums online it appears that this is normal so i'm not worrying about it as much as what I did. I take Evening Primrose oil to help with the pain, which may help you if you are experiencing similar symptoms to myself!

    My lump turned out to be Fibroadenoma in case you didn't see my previous comment. If you are going through something similar to myself, please don't be driving yourself crazy! The consultant told me that lumps found in younger women are more than likely Fibroadenomas or Cysts because of our ever changing hormones!
